Foreign Minister Malki holds several meetings with his counterparts on the sidelines of the UNGA meetings

Minister of Foreign Affairs and Expatriates Riyad Malki today held several meetings in New York with his counterparts on the sidelines of the 78th session of the United Nations General Assembly during which he briefed them on the latest developments in the occupied Palestinian territories. Malki met with his Canadian, Mexican, Bulgarian, Dutch, and Nicaraguan counterparts and told them that Israel's violations against the Palestinian people and land demand their immediate intervention to force Israel to stop these violations. He said the Israeli escalation on the ground threatens peace and security in the region and the world. The foreign ministers reiterated their governments' support for the two-state solution to end the Palestinian-Israeli conflict.
